How can I block/permit a range of IP addresses in a firewall rule?

0

If you can summarize the IP addresses with a CIDR mask, you can enter a rule to apply to those hosts. For example, 10.0.0.8-10.0.0.15 can be summarized with 10.0.0.8/29.
